Solution for 25=65-2x equation:


Simplifying
25 = 65 + -2x

Solving
25 = 65 + -2x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'2x' to each side of the equation.
25 + 2x = 65 + -2x + 2x

Combine like terms: -2x + 2x = 0
25 + 2x = 65 + 0
25 + 2x = 65

Add '-25' to each side of the equation.
25 + -25 + 2x = 65 + -25

Combine like terms: 25 + -25 = 0
0 + 2x = 65 + -25
2x = 65 + -25

Combine like terms: 65 + -25 = 40
2x = 40

Divide each side by '2'.
x = 20

Simplifying
x = 20
